DO YOUR THING DIFFERENTLY AND VOTE THE RIGHT CANDIDATES

 
February 23rd 2019

“Enter through the narrow gate; for the gate is wide and the road is easy that leads to destruction, and there are many who take it. For the gate is narrow and the road is hard that leads to life, and there are few who find it” - Matthew 7:13-14



Today, Nigerians are heading for the polls to elect their leaders who will take charge of the affairs of their country for the next four years. It is a very difficult moment for those in Nigeria because making a good choice has never been easy! In moments like this, it is very important to saturate our decisions in prayer so we can get the Holy Spirit’s approval to our choices since He sees the hearts of men and can warn us if we are leaning in the wrong direction in our decisions. We must remember we are not voting for perfect people, but certainly, some people are better than others and the Holy Spirit can give us spiritual insight as to who these men and women might be. Candidates can fool people by their persuasive rhetoric, but they cannot fool God and if we stay close to God today, He will guide us in the best choice for each of the offices. Remember, “by their fruits, ye shall know them.” Do not let a group action affect your choices; one very big tragedy in life is to be persuaded or dissuaded by group opinion, especially in matters where your destiny and that of millions of others will be greatly affected. Hold your grounds if you believe you are right in the choices that you have made. It does not matter whether anyone else believes in your opinion or not, provided your decision is based on love, justice, and equity. For today and in all other days of your life, you must hold your ground all to the glory of God, and not to please anyone. You simply would do what is right for yourself and for your country. Remember beloved, there are two basic reasons you must hold your grounds always: ONE - In order to make our world a better place. Our world today is going through turbulence, partly due to the inability of the majority to uphold truth, justice, and righteousness. If more people embrace love, justice, and equity, darkness and evil will disappear. TWO – In order to take a leap of faith. At times, we are unable to dare into any venture just because the majority thinks we are crazy. You cannot determine the success of a venture before you have started.


Therefore, I tell you today that your choice of leaders must be done along the path of justice, equity, and righteousness. God is telling you to uphold justice, love, and righteousness at all times and never to do otherwise because somebody else disagrees with you. Very often, people come together in support of a candidate for election not because he or she is good, but because everybody is supporting them. Your choice must roll down justice like waters, and righteousness like overflowing stream.

Mary Lawrence-Dokpesi was born in Nigeria to Patrick Abuda Obeakemhe and Juliana Fatimatu Obeakemhe, both from Ogbona Town. With a master’s degree in law, she was called to the bar at the age of twenty-two, and she is currently the principle partner of the law firm Mary Lawrence-Dokpesi & Associates. She is also the founder of two philanthropic organizations: the Living Waters Mission and the Rose Croix Foundation. In addition to law, Lawrence-Dokpesi was drawn to spiritual pursuits at an early age, having begun studying philosophy, theology, chaplaincy, and spirit therapy by the age of eighteen. Inspired by her spiritual calling, she has produced ten intensively researched manuscripts on spiritual matters. Although Understanding the Spiritual was the last to be written, it is the first to be published. Lawrence-Dokpesi is a mother and a wife living in the city of Abuja, Nigeria.
